mysql多列组合唯一

更新时间:02-11 教程 由 颜初 分享

在MySQL中,我们可以使用UNIQUE关键字来设置多列组合唯一约束。具体来说,我们可以在创建表时使用UNIQUE关键字来指定需要设置为唯一的列组合。例如,下面的SQL语句可以在创建表时为两个列设置唯一约束:

ytable (

id INT NOT NULL,ame VARCHAR(50) NOT NULL,ame)

ameame列的值都不能完全相同。如果试图插入重复的值,MySQL将会抛出一个错误。

需要注意的是,多列组合唯一约束并不是必须的,有时候单独的唯一约束已经足够了。但是,当我们需要确保多个列的值的组合是唯一的时候,多列组合唯一约束就非常有用了。

总之,MySQL多列组合唯一约束是一种非常实用的约束,可以有效地避免数据冗余和错误。在使用MySQL时,我们可以通过使用UNIQUE关键字来为多个列设置唯一约束,从而实现多列组合唯一约束的效果。

声明:关于《mysql多列组合唯一》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2136083.html